Manufacturers of cutlery will often sell their products in open or single item stock. Open stock buying, usually makes sense, when the buyer needs to add to their existing collection. Some purchasers are in need of more then one of the same piece for various reasons. Perhaps they want duplicate or even triplicate copies of the same utensils. In particular there may be two chefs in the kitchen needing the same knifes and in some cases it's just nice to have a spare for those times when the first piece was stolen or lost.
There are a number of reasons why an individual may choose single knives over the prepackaged set. Some people simply prefer to use a single knife. They would then want multiples of that knife, or want it in a size not included in the set. Similarly, a chef may frequently prepare specific recipes that require the use of a specific blade such as a cleaver.
Most cutlery fall into one of these two categories- Fine edge knives are the classics of cutlery. They are the choice of chefs and accomplished cooks because they usually have a good weight and feel. The blade is also much sharper which allows for finer more precise cuts. However, fine edge knives do require some maintenance, such as steeling.
